The market for thermoplastic materials used in clear orthodontic aligners is experiencing significant growth, driven by advancements in dental technology and increasing consumer demand for aesthetic dental treatments. Thermoplastic materials, such as polyurethane, polyethylene terephthalate glycol (PETG), polycarbonate, and polyvinyl chloride (PVC), are pivotal in manufacturing clear aligners due to their properties such as clarity, flexibility, and biocompatibility. These materials allow for the production of virtually invisible aligners that are both effective in correcting dental misalignments and appealing to patients seeking less noticeable orthodontic solutions.

Polyurethane is a leading material in the thermoplastic material for clear orthodontic aligner market, prized for its exceptional elasticity and excellent transparency, which are crucial for the aesthetic and functional requirements of orthodontic aligners. This material provides a comfortable fit and is less noticeable, making it highly preferred by patients seeking inconspicuous dental correction solutions.
The market demand for polyurethane-based aligners is driven by these patient-centric features, coupled with the material's durability and resistance to staining, which ensures the aligners remain clear throughout the treatment period. The adaptability of polyurethane to various manufacturing processes, including injection molding and 3D printing, further enhances its appeal to aligner manufacturers looking for efficient production workflows. Polyurethane holds a significant share in the market, with its usage anticipated to grow as orthodontic professionals and patients recognize its benefits.
Polyethylene terephthalate glycol, or PETG, is another prominent material in the market. Known for its robustness and clarity, PETG is an ideal choice for aligner fabrication, offering a balance between performance and aesthetic appeal. It provides a rigid yet flexible structure that effectively moves teeth into the desired position without causing discomfort to the patient. PETG's high-impact resistance minimizes the risk of breakage during use, which is particularly important for the durability of orthodontic aligners.
The material's ease of processing and compatibility with sterilization processes align well with the high-volume production requirements of aligner manufacturers. The market for PETG-based aligners is expanding as manufacturers leverage its properties to enhance product quality and meet the increasing consumer demand for reliable and effective orthodontic treatments. The segment's growth is supported by the ongoing development of advanced PETG formulations designed to optimize the performance and aesthetic outcomes of clear aligners.

Retainers become essential in ensuring the stability of the treatment results, following the active phase of orthodontic treatment using aligners. The retainers segment in the thermoplastic material market is crucial as it addresses the need for long-term post-treatment care. Retainers are typically made from the same thermoplastic materials as aligners but are designed to hold teeth in their new positions rather than move them.
This application's market scope is expanding with the growing number of patients completing orthodontic treatments with aligners, necessitating the use of retainers to maintain the alignment achieved. The durability and comfort of thermoplastic materials make them ideal for retainers, which are often worn for extended periods. The ongoing need for retainers ensures a steady demand within the thermoplastic material market, reinforcing its role as a key segment in the overall market landscape.

Orthodontic laboratories are another crucial end-user in themarket. These specialized laboratories play a key role in the production and innovation of clear aligners. Equipped with advanced manufacturing technologies, such as CAD/CAM systems and 3D printers, orthodontic laboratories have the technical capabilities to process various thermoplastic materials into custom aligners based on precise digital impressions provided by dental clinics.
The scale of production in these laboratories varies from small custom batches to large-scale manufacturing, depending on the partnerships and networks they maintain with dental practices. The expertise and technological capacity of orthodontic laboratories enable them to experiment with and optimize different thermoplastic materials to achieve the best outcomes in terms of product quality and treatment efficacy.
The ongoing collaboration between these laboratories and dental clinics, coupled with continuous technological advancements, ensures a steady demand for thermoplastic materials as laboratories strive to meet the high standards required in orthodontic aligner production.
